2. How to Find a Forgotten Password

Strategies to Retrieve Forgotten Passwords

If you have forgotten your password but are not sure how to reset it, there are several strategies you can try to regain access. Here are a few techniques to help you find the password you are missing:

  • Try a few common passwords that may have similar patterns. Sometimes people use the same passwords for multiple accounts, so it may help to try some combinations of words that would be easy for you to remember.
  • Look around your environment. Passwords are often written down and stored in a safe place such as a notepad. Try searching for any notes or documents that may have the password written somewhere on them.
  • Contact your email provider. Many email providers can help reset passwords if you can provide enough information to prove that it is your account. This is usually done by verifying existing data such as the date you created your account, associated phone numbers, or recovery emails.
  • Utilize password manager software. Password manager software helps to store passwords and personal information, which can make it easier to find forgotten passwords.

With the strategies above, hopefully you can find the forgotten password, or reset it for a new one. If all else fails, contact the customer service team of the service for which you have the forgotten password.

4. Keep Your iPhone Password Secure

Learning the Basics of Protecting Your iPhone Password

It’s essential to protect your iPhone passwords by following a few easy steps. Here are four ways to secure your online information and safeguard your device against potential attackers:

  • Set a Strong Password: Create a letter and number combination password that’s strong and difficult to guess. You can also set a password-based authentication requirement every time you unlock your device.
  • Don’t Share Your Passwords: Don’t share passwords with other users or post it anywhere online. Strong passwords should remain secret!
  • Harden Your Passwords: Use two-factor authentication, which sends an email or text message with a special code that confirms your identity when logging in to any of your apps or devices.
  • Stay Up to Date: Update your iPhone regularly with the latest software and security patches. This ensures that your device is secure and up to date with the latest security fixes.

By taking these precautionary steps, you can ensure your device and online accounts are safer from possible malicious activities or breaches.
